WebNov 29, 2024 · The head, or epiphysis (epi- meaning "upon") of a bone refers to the rounded portion found at either ends of the bone. The neck, or metaphysis (meta- meaning "after", or "subsequent to") is the widest part … WebMar 6, 2024 · The apophysis is a site of tendon or ligament attachment, as compared to the epiphysis which contributes to a joint, and for that reason, it is also called 'traction epiphysis'. When unfused, apophyses can easily be mistaken for fractures.
